When it comes to organizing your workspace or entertainment setup, short cables offer a multitude of benefits. By minimizing excess length, these cables help to maximize space and reduce clutter. This is particularly important in environments where every inch counts, such as small offices or home theaters. Gone are the days of tangled wires taking up valuable real estate; short cables allow for cleaner setups and a more aesthetically pleasing arrangement. Additionally, using shorter cables can enhance performance as they often come with lower levels of signal degradation, ensuring you receive the best possible connection.
Moreover, adopting short cables can lead to increased efficiency in both work and play. With less cable slack, you’ll find it easier to maneuver around your space, thus saving time and reducing frustration when reaching for your devices. The utilization of short cables also encourages a more streamlined approach to technology management, as the reduced length allows for simpler maintenance and organization. Ultimately, switching to short cables not only promotes an efficient environment but also creates a more functional and enjoyable user experience.

When it comes to choosing the right short cable, several factors come into play. First and foremost, you need to consider the type of devices you'll be connecting. For example, if you're using the cable for charging or data transfer between a smartphone and a laptop, ensure it supports the necessary specifications such as USB-C, Lightning, or micro-USB. Additionally, think about the length of the cable you require; shorter cables are generally more convenient for travel but may limit reach in certain settings. Understanding these essentials will guide you towards making a more informed decision.
Next, quality matters significantly when selecting a short cable. Look for cables that offer durable construction, such as reinforced connectors and robust insulation. You can find cables that meet high standards set by organizations like USB-IF. It's essential to avoid counterfeit cables which may not perform as promised and could damage your devices.
